Volga - Wikipedia
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/VolgaWebThe Volga (/ ˈ v ɒ l ɡ ə, ˈ v oʊ l ɡ ə /; Russian: Во́лга) is the longest river in Europe.Situated in Russia, it flows through Central Russia to Southern Russia and into the Caspian Sea.The Volga has a length of 3,531 km (2,194 mi), and a catchment area of 1,360,000 km 2 (530,000 sq mi) which is more than twice the size of Ukraine.It is also Europe's largest …
